    Rosie O'Donnell didn't expect to look so different after shedding 50 pounds.

    The 'View' co-host lost the weight after she suffered a heart attack in 2012 and while she is pleased to have piled off some pounds, she isn't quite "jumping for joy" about her new figure and gets emotional looking at herself.


    She said: "The fact that I look so different has been difficult and unexpected.

    "Everyone assumes that obese people would just be jumping for joy that they were healthier and thinner and able to fit into store-bought sizes, we don't have to go to the plus store.

    "But it's also filled with a lot of emotional turbulence you wouldn't expect."

    The 52-year-old star married Michelle Rounds in 2012 and admits her second wife encouraged her to lose some weight and be healthy.

    Speaking to ABC News on the set of 'The View' - which she has returned to after leaving the programme in 2007 - she added: "When we decided to get married, she said, 'But I want 40 more years and I don't want you to die on me, so you need to do something for your health.'

    "I have a group that I go to, where women talk about how they feel.

    "A lot of marriages break up once one person gets healthy. Luckily, my wife is very healthy, [has] always been healthy, loves me and encourages me to be healthy."

    Rosie was previously married to former Nickelodeon marketing ex ecutive Kelli Carpenter in 2004 but they divorced in 2007.

    In July, ABC confirmed Rosie was to return to 'The View' to co-host alongside Whoopi Goldberg.

    The network announced the news on Twitter, tweeting: "It's official! ABC confirms Rosie O'Donnell returns as co-host of #TheView w/ moderator Whoopi Goldberg for Season 18 (sic)."
